Webhook - Инструкция для отправки лидов
Отправка лидов на свой сервер. Инструкция для отправки лидов.
Для отправки лидов на свой сервер или в свою CRM следуйте инструкции ниже.
ШАГ 1 (Создание скрипта обработчика)
Методом POST, будут отправлены следующие параметры:
Поле | Тип | Описание |
---|---|---|
Id |
Целочисленное значение | Идентификатор заявки в нашей системе. |
FullName |
Символьное значение 63 знака | Ф.И.О. клиента. |
PhoneNumbers |
Символьное значение 63 знака. | № телефонов клиента, разделенные через запятую (если несколько) в международном формате E.164. Например: «+79261112233,+79221112233». |
Email |
Символьное значение 63 знака | Адрес электронной почты клиента. |
Brief |
Символьное значение 2047 знаков | Дополнительная информация о заказе. |
Comment |
Символьное значение 255 знаков | Служебный комментарий к заявке. |
Topic |
Символьное значение 255 знаков | Тема обращения. |
Region |
Символьное значение 127 знаков | Регион, указанный клиентом. Например: «Москва». |
RegionDeterminedISOCode |
Символьное значение 6 знаков | ISO-код региона клиента, определенного системой. Например: «RU-MOS». |
RegionDeterminedName |
Символьное значение 127 знаков | Название региона клиента, определенного системой. |
ProjectId |
Целочисленное значение | Идентификатор проекта. |
ProjectName |
Символьное значение 63 знака | Название проекта. |
ChannelId |
Целочисленное значение | Идентификатор канала. |
ChannelName |
Символьное значение 63 знака | Название канала. |
IPAddress |
Символьное значение 45 знаков | IP-адрес клиента. |
UrlReferrer |
Символьное значение 1023 знака | URL-адрес страницы, с которой отправлена заявка. |
UrlSource |
Символьное значение 1023 знака | URL-адрес источника перехода на сайт. |
UserAgent |
Символьное значение 255 знаков | UserAgent клиента. |
RecordUrl |
Символьное значение 1023 знака | URL-записи разговора с клиентом. |
CustomParams[XYZ] |
Символьное значение 1023 знака | Пользовательские параметры. Вместо XYZ будет указано имя параметра. Конструкций вида CustomParams[XYZ] может быть передано несколько, в зависимости от количества параметров. |
Формат ответа
Мы анализируем ответы вашего сервера в кодировке UTF-8 и в формате JSON.
В случае успешного запроса: { status: "success", id: "...", message: "..." }
В случае ошибки: { status: "error", message: "..." }
или код ответа сервера отличный от 200, если заявка не была обработана вашим сервером.
ШАГ 2 (Настройка проекта)
- После того как вы создали обработчик POST-запросов, перейдите в настройки проекта и выберите для добавления интеграцию по Webhook.
- Укажите URL-адрес обработчика в настройках интеграции для выбранного проекта.
- Опционально укажите значения заголовка «Authorization», если вашему серверу требуется авторизация.
- Сохраните настройки проекта для применения изменений.